An aerial view shows the damage to the Guajataca dam in the aftermath of Hurricane Maria, in Quebradillas, Puerto Rico September 23, 2017. REUTERS/Alvin Baez TPX IMAGES OF THE DAY

This aerial view captures the devastating aftermath of Hurricane Maria on the Guajataca dam in Quebradillas, Puerto Rico. The image, taken by Alvin Baez for Reuters Images, showcases the sheer power of nature as it reveals the extensive damage caused to this vital infrastructure. The once sturdy and imposing structure now stands as a testament to the destructive force of hurricanes. The exterior of the dam is visibly shattered and broken, with chunks missing from its walls. The surrounding area is engulfed by water that has breached its boundaries, creating a chaotic splash against what remains of the dam.
